This sounds great. I will be teaching an iphone programming course next year and I would very much like to use the course as an opportunity to introduce students to caml. I know that there are others gearing up for iphone programming courses who aren't thrilled with the idea of teaching Objective C. If you were to post your resources on a web site it might lower the barrier to entry for more people to use ocaml + your wrappers rather than Objective C. The summary is that we model Cocoa objects > as OCaml objects. We have a layer that wraps OCaml objects in > smallish ObjC objects for use on the ObjC side, and wraps ObjC > objects in smallish OCaml objects for use on the OCaml side. The > layer then translates between these representations as required > for calls into iPhoneOS and Cocoa Touch from OCaml (asking for > iPhone OS services) and into OCaml from iPhoneOS (for event > handling). > >>> We also made a small fix to the ARM code generator >> >> I am very interested in any and all information needed to get a >> correct OCaml port suitable for use in App Store applications. >> Please share! > > OK, I'll gather up our patch and send it to the list. I want to > separate out our changes from those of Toshiyuki Maeda [1]. > > As I said, our patch fixes calls to external C float functions > such as floor(), sin(), and so on. There is special handling in > ocamlopt to allow them to be unboxed, but the ABI of the existing > ARM code generator doesn't match the iPhone ABI. > > Regards, > > Jeff Scofield > Seattle > > [1] http://web.yl.is.s.u-tokyo.ac.jp/~tosh/ocaml-on-iphone/ > > _______________________________________________ > Caml-list mailing list.
